When's the best time for a beach vacation in Guanico Abajo?
You can plan your beach trip with this snapshot of weather throughout the year in Guanico Abajo: The hottest months are usually March and April with an average temp of 80°F, while the coldest months are January and December with an average of 77°F. The rainiest months in Guanico Abajo are October, August, June, and November, with each month seeing an average of 18 inches of rainfall.
